An Opportunistic and Adaptable Diet
The sacred ibis employs an opportunistic, generalist approach to finding food. As naturalists have long observed, the species feeds on a wide variety of prey and rarely seems to pass up a meal. The ibis’s diverse diet likely helps account for its ability to flourish across wetlands, marshes, mudflats, garbage dumps, and agricultural fields throughout its range.
Sacred ibises are carnivorous and feed mainly on various invertebrates, small vertebrates, and eggs. On the invertebrate side, they consume insects like grasshoppers, crickets, beetles, caterpillars, ants, and fly larvae. They also eat spiders, scorpions, snails, earthworms, crabs, crayfish, and shrimp. Small reptiles and amphibians like frogs, toads, newts, and lizards are also common prey. Mammalian prey includes rodents such as mice, voles, and rats. And ibis sometimes feed on small fish in shallow water.
But the sacred ibis’s diet is not limited to meat. These opportunistic foragers also regularly feed on vegetable matter to supplement their nutrition. Cereal grains are a major part of their plant-based diet, including wheat, rice, and barley. They also consume bread, peas, beans, seeds, fruits, and berries.
Finally, the sacred ibis eagerly feeds on eggs and young chicks whenever the opportunity arises. They raid the nests of other bird species to consume eggs and hatchlings. And in mixed colonies, sacred ibises may resort to cannibalism of their own eggs or young.
Clearly, the sacred ibis will eat just about anything it can swallow. This varied, protein-rich diet allows the species to thrive across diverse environments.
Foraging Strategies
To find such a wide array of prey, the sacred ibis employs an equally diverse array of foraging techniques. Their curved beaks allow them to probe deeply in mud or grassy vegetation. They capture land-based prey by picking it directly off the ground or vegetation. In shallow water, they will shuffle their feet to disturb and uncover hidden aquatic animals.
Here is a breakdown of their main foraging strategies:
Probing: The ibis inserts its long, curved beak into mud, sand, or soil up to 6 inches deep to feel for and capture buried prey.
Gleaning: The ibis picks invertebrates, eggs, or plant matter directly from the ground or vegetation surfaces.
Hawking: The ibis catches flying insects and other airborne prey in mid-air.
Tactic feeding: The ibis follows large ungulates and livestock to catch insects or small vertebrates stirred up by their movement.
Ground Picking: The ibis picks up food items directly from the ground while walking.
Wading: The ibis wades through shallow water while shuffling its feet, disturbing bottom sediments to uncover buried aquatic prey.
Scavenging: The ibis scavenges opportunistically on dead fish, animals, garbage, and human food waste.
The ibis often employs multiple feeding techniques in succession while foraging. This versatility allows them to exploit a wide range of habitat types, from wetlands to grasslands to human settlements. By not relying too heavily on any single food source or method of capture, sacred ibises are able to adapt to changing environmental conditions and maximize their feeding success.
Habitats
The diverse feeding habits of the sacred ibis allow it to thrive in a variety of habitat types across its range:
Wetlands: The ibis wades along marshy edges and mudflats probing for crabs, fish, and other aquatic prey. Common wetland habitats include mangrove swamps, marshes, deltas, floodplains, and wet meadows.
Grasslands: The ibis gleans insect prey from low vegetation and probes for invertebrates hiding underground. Grassland habitats include savannas, pastures, fields, prairies and plains.
Agricultural Areas: The ibis follows tractors to pick up disturbed invertebrates and also forages on rodents in croplands and farms. They opportunistically scavenge on spilled grain and fruit.
Garbage Dumps: The ibis feeds readily on human food waste, especially grain products, at landfills and garbage dumps near human settlements.
Urban Areas: The adaptable ibis has learned to find food in city parks, gardens, zoos, and anywhere humans make food available, whether intentionally or unintentionally.
From the remote wetlands of sub-Saharan Africa to the garbage-strewn alleys of Middle Eastern cities, the sacred ibis has proven able to exploit a wide range of habitats, providing it with access to plenty of its favorite invertebrate prey.
Feeding Behavior
Sacred ibises exhibit flexible feeding behaviors that also facilitate their ability to take advantage of diverse food resources.
They are diurnal and do most of their foraging during daylight hours. In the early morning and evenings, they often congregate in large flocks at communal roosting and nesting sites.
Ibises may forage alone, but more often move together in small flocks. This increases their ability to locate patchy food resources across expansive wetlands and grasslands. When prey is abundant, larger aggregations of hundreds of ibises may converge to feed communally.
They regularly follow large herbivores like cattle or buffalo out to pasture. The ibises pick off the insects and small animals disturbed by the movements of these large grazers. This “tactic feeding” behavior results in productive foraging opportunities.
Sacred ibises are also highly adaptable and will readily exploit new habitat types and food resources, especially those resulting from human activities. Their willingness to feed at landfills and in urban areas demonstrates their flexible survival strategies.
Overall, the combination of diverse feeding techniques, social foraging in flocks, and adaptive behavior allows sacred ibises to thrive across a wide range of ever-changing habitats.
Breeding and Chick Diets
During the breeding season, sacred ibises gather in large noisy colonies that may include thousands of nesting pairs.
They build platform nests out of sticks, usually alongside water and in trees, bushes, or reedbeds for protection. Males and females share nest construction duties.
Females lay between 3 to 5 eggs, which incubate for about 3 weeks. The eggs are elliptical, light blue-green, with brown blotches for camouflage. Parent birds take turns sitting on the eggs.
Once hatched, both parents share responsibility for feeding the nestlings. For the first two weeks, the chicks cannot even hold up their heads. So the adult birds regurgitate pre-digested food directly into the hungry hatchlings’ mouths.
The diet fed to chicks includes:
– Insects: grasshoppers, crickets, caterpillars
– Spiders
– Earthworms
– Snails and crabs
– Small fish and frogs
– Rodents like mice and voles
After about 14 days, the nestlings develop enough neck strength to start picking up food dropped by the parents into the nest. The chicks fledge at around 4 weeks old but continue to beg parents for food for at least two more weeks as they learn to forage on their own. Parents selectively feed the strongest chicks in the nest.
Provisioning growing chicks requires increased foraging effort by the adult ibises. So breeding colonies are often situated near highly productive wetlands or agricultural areas that provide abundant food resources during this energetically demanding period.

Food and Habitat Pressures
The sacred ibis continues to thrive across much of its range today. But in certain areas, habitat loss and declining food resources present growing challenges.
For example, drying of wetlands in sub-Saharan Africa from climate change threatens to reduce available habitat and prey populations for ibises in parts of their ancestral breeding range.
Agricultural intensification and overgrazing have degraded natural wetlands in some regions. Use of pesticides eliminates the insect prey ibises rely on.
Urbanization and the loss of suitable nesting sites have displaced ibises from historical breeding colonies in Egypt.
Declining fish stocks due to water pollution and wetland degradation impact ibises in the Middle East. In Saudi Arabia, ibises have disappeared from areas where livestock overgrazing has diminished wetland vegetation.
Fortunately, sacred ibises remain common globally and are classified as a species of Least Concern by the IUCN Red List. Where habitat and food resources dwindle locally, ibises adapt by dispersing to new areas in search of better foraging opportunities. Their flexible feeding behaviors continue to ensure the species remains widespread from Africa to Europe.
But continued wetland conservation efforts are needed to protect crucial ibis breeding colonies in certain regions. With adequate suitable habitat, this adaptable bird will continue exploiting its famously diverse diet for millennia to come.
